excel怎么限制表格的行数

excel怎么限制表格的行数

在Excel中限制表格行数的方法有多种,包括隐藏多余行、设置打印区域、使用数据验证等。其中,隐藏多余行的方法最为常用,可以通过隐藏不需要的行来达到限制表格行数的效果。具体操作步骤如下:

  1. 隐藏多余行:首先选择需要限制的行数范围之外的所有行,然后右键点击选择“隐藏”。
  2. 设置打印区域:通过设置打印区域来限制显示和打印的行数。
  3. 使用数据验证:可以通过数据验证功能来控制用户只能在指定范围内输入数据。
  4. 使用VBA代码:对于高级用户,可以编写VBA代码来实现对行数的限制。

以下我们将详细介绍这些方法及其操作步骤和适用场景。

一、隐藏多余行

隐藏多余行是最简单直接的方法之一,通过隐藏不需要的行,可以有效地限制表格的行数。

1. 步骤一:选择多余的行

  1. 打开Excel表格,点击表格左侧的行号,选择需要限制的行数范围之外的所有行。例如,你希望表格只显示前20行,那么你需要选择第21行到最后一行。
  2. 按住Shift键,滚动鼠标或拖动滑块选择所有多余的行。

2. 步骤二:隐藏选择的行

  1. 右键点击选择的多余行。
  2. 从右键菜单中选择“隐藏”选项。

通过以上步骤,表格中多余的行将被隐藏,仅显示需要的行数。

二、设置打印区域

设置打印区域是另一种常用的方法,特别适用于需要打印表格的场景。通过设置打印区域,可以限制只打印指定的行数。

1. 步骤一:选择打印区域

  1. 打开Excel表格,选择需要打印的行数范围。例如,选择A1到A20单元格。
  2. 在Excel菜单栏中,点击“页面布局”选项卡。

2. 步骤二:设置打印区域

  1. 在“页面布局”选项卡中,点击“打印区域”按钮。
  2. 从下拉菜单中选择“设置打印区域”。

通过以上步骤,Excel只会打印设置的区域,其他行将不会被打印。

三、使用数据验证

数据验证功能可以用于限制用户只能在指定范围内输入数据,从而间接地限制表格的行数。

1. 步骤一:选择数据验证范围

  1. 打开Excel表格,选择需要限制输入数据的行数范围。例如,选择A1到A20单元格。
  2. 在Excel菜单栏中,点击“数据”选项卡。

2. 步骤二:设置数据验证规则

  1. 在“数据”选项卡中,点击“数据验证”按钮。
  2. 在弹出的“数据验证”对话框中,选择“设置”选项卡。
  3. 在“允许”下拉菜单中选择“自定义”。
  4. 在“公式”框中输入验证公式,如=ROW(A1)<=20

通过以上步骤,Excel将限制用户只能在指定的行数范围内输入数据。

四、使用VBA代码

对于高级用户,可以通过编写VBA代码来实现对行数的限制。这种方法更加灵活和可定制。

1. 步骤一:打开VBA编辑器

  1. 打开Excel表格,按Alt + F11键打开VBA编辑器。
  2. 在VBA编辑器中,点击“插入”菜单,选择“模块”选项。

2. 步骤二:编写VBA代码

在新建的模块中,输入以下VBA代码:

Sub LimitRows()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

ws.Rows("21:1048576").Hidden = True

End Sub

将代码中的Sheet1替换为你的工作表名称,并调整行数范围。

3. 步骤三:运行VBA代码

  1. 在VBA编辑器中,点击“运行”按钮或按F5键运行代码。
  2. 返回Excel表格,你会发现多余的行已被隐藏。

通过以上步骤,利用VBA代码可以灵活地限制表格的行数。

五、总结

在Excel中限制表格的行数可以通过多种方法实现,包括隐藏多余行、设置打印区域、使用数据验证以及编写VBA代码。这些方法各有优缺点,适用于不同的场景和需求。隐藏多余行操作简单直接,适用于大多数用户;设置打印区域适用于需要打印表格的场景;使用数据验证可以限制用户输入数据的范围;编写VBA代码则适用于高级用户,提供更高的灵活性和可定制性。

通过掌握这些方法,你可以根据具体需求选择合适的方式来限制Excel表格的行数,从而提高工作效率和数据管理的准确性。无论是日常数据处理还是专业数据分析,这些技巧都将为你提供有力的支持。

相关问答FAQs:

1. 如何在Excel中限制表格的行数?

在Excel中,你可以通过以下步骤来限制表格的行数:

  • 首先,选中你想要限制行数的表格。
  • 接着,在Excel菜单栏中选择“数据”选项卡。
  • 在“数据”选项卡中,点击“数据工具”组下的“数据验证”按钮。
  • 在弹出的数据验证对话框中,选择“设置”选项卡。
  • 在“设置”选项卡中,选择“自定义”选项。
  • 在“公式”框中,输入以下公式:=ROW()<=n (其中n是你想要限制的最大行数)。
  • 点击“确定”按钮,即可完成限制表格行数的设置。

2. 如何取消Excel表格的行数限制?

如果你想取消在Excel中设置的表格行数限制,可以按照以下步骤进行操作:

  • 首先,选中已设置行数限制的表格。
  • 接着,在Excel菜单栏中选择“数据”选项卡。
  • 在“数据”选项卡中,点击“数据工具”组下的“数据验证”按钮。
  • 在弹出的数据验证对话框中,选择“设置”选项卡。
  • 在“设置”选项卡中,选择“自定义”选项。
  • 清空“公式”框中的内容。
  • 点击“确定”按钮,即可取消表格行数限制。

3. 表格行数超过限制后,如何显示错误信息?

如果在Excel中设置了表格的行数限制,并且用户输入的行数超过了限制,你可以通过以下步骤来显示错误信息:

  • 首先,选中你想要限制行数的表格。
  • 接着,在Excel菜单栏中选择“数据”选项卡。
  • 在“数据”选项卡中,点击“数据工具”组下的“数据验证”按钮。
  • 在弹出的数据验证对话框中,选择“设置”选项卡。
  • 在“设置”选项卡中,选择“自定义”选项。
  • 在“输入信息”选项卡中,勾选“显示输入消息”复选框。
  • 在“输入消息”文本框中,输入你想要显示的错误信息。
  • 点击“确定”按钮,即可设置表格行数超过限制时显示的错误信息。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4735381

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部